Olamide delivers A.M. to the world with Ojaju

Published by

Budding Afro Pop sensation, Ahamdi Ikechukwu Ononuju-McErnest, known as A.M, has released a blazing new song titled Ojaju. The new single produced by Jfem features YBNL boss, Olamide.

Despite being out of the country for a while, the delectable act who also doubles as a fitness trainer has been on the music scene for quite some time with hit singles like IMAKA and MISS AFRICANA, released in 2015.The singles caused quite a buzz on social media and topped music charts. Ojaju is set to relaunch him into mainstream music.

Olamide’s lyrical power was manifest in the song, blending an enthralling vocal delivery by AM to a height of music ecstasy.

Speaking about his collaboration with Olamide, he said, “It was a great experience working with Olamide. He is one of the most talented people I’ve met and worked with”.

The Uptown Nation Music signee is currently on a media tour to promote OJAJU as well as other soon- to- be- unveiled projects. His fresh approach to Afrobeat is definitely one to look out for!
